Good day Reddit! So I recorded this .aac file and stupid-me moved it to my OneDrive and suddenly the file can't be played anymore. I checked and this happens with every file I moved using the Samsung Files app. I do realise it was quite stupid to move it, instead of, to copy it.. Well so since the file still has a size I hoped that it's just some corrupted headers.
I tried some of the following to no avail:
VLC
Audacity raw data import
untrunc
hexdump
some random commands with ffmpeg
The file is a stereo 256kbps, 48 kHz file, with a duration of 2:22.
Does anyone know anything I could try or is it a lost cause? Here is the file, in case someone wants to take a look at it:

The daily limit on last.fm for scrobbles is most likely 669 scrobbles. That means you could listen to over 5 hours of music if the songs are 30 seconds long to hit this. You'd need over a day to hit this, if you listened to songs that are 2:30 long. Y'all have absolutely NOTHING to worry about.
If you hit the limit, then you will be rate limited. And no, you cannot delete one scrobble and then release it again. You won't be able to scrobble for the day.
